Toledo bend, the beginning of april. 71 degs outside 64 deg water temp. bluebird skies. a little wind. caught fish in the morning on x rap and senkos. the bite slowed, so i moved out a bit and found a ton of fish on a drop off from 7 ft to 20 ft. fish were stacked and suspending between 10 and 15 ft. i through tons of cranks in that range in many different colors, and could not get a single bite.why,why,why?

I'm sure there are alot of suspended post spawn fish on T Bend.

I like to look at suspended fish as in-active fish for the most part.

Sometimes you have to get them started.    I still like ripping spoons for suspended fish.    Once you get one going, the rest will follow suit some times.    

How far off the bottom where they suspended?

What size of cranks did you throw?    Sometimes size matters.     Bluedbird skies and very little wind normally pulls fish closer to cover,

And just cause the graph shows fish don't make them bass.

like matt said. are you sure they were bass?
